The Engineering Philosophy Behind 300+ MPH
Achieving a top speed of over 300 mph requires more than just a potent engine. It demands a perfect marriage between drag reduction and downforce—a paradoxical challenge. The fastest cars in the world today utilize advanced computational fluid dynamics (CFD) to slice through the air while maintaining enough stability to keep the chassis planted. As we look at the 2026 landscape, the world’s fastest road cars are increasingly utilizing hybrid and fully electric powertrains, which offer instantaneous torque and modular power distribution that traditional combustion engines struggle to match.
The Top 20 Fastest Road Cars of 2026
McLaren F1 (240.1 mph)
Though it debuted decades ago, the McLaren F1 remains the gold standard for pure driving engagement. Its naturally aspirated V12 set a benchmark that defined an era, proving that lightweight construction is just as critical as raw power.
W Motors Fenyr SuperSport (245 mph)
Designed in Dubai, this hypercar leverages Porsche-tuned Ruf engines. It is a masterclass in aggressive design, serving as a testament to the global reach of modern high-end performance engineering.
Saleen S7 Twin Turbo (248 mph)
An American icon of the mid-2000s, the Saleen S7 proved that a boutique manufacturer could compete with the European giants. Its twin-turbocharged V8 architecture remains a benchmark for raw, unassisted power delivery.
Koenigsegg Gemera & CCXR (248 mph)
Koenigsegg is synonymous with innovation. The Gemera, a “Mega-GT,” showcases how a plug-in hybrid system can deliver unprecedented power, while the classic CCXR remains a staple of high-speed capability.
Aspark Owl (249 mph)
Representing the new guard of electric performance, the Japanese-built Aspark Owl is a master of acceleration. Its small, high-discharge battery pack is optimized for the kind of “sprint” performance that dominates 2026 industry discussions.
Ultima RS (250 mph)
The Ultima RS is the “purist’s choice.” As a high-performance kit car, it achieves its speed through an incredible power-to-weight ratio, stripping away luxury to focus solely on velocity.
McLaren Speedtail (250 mph)
The spiritual successor to the F1, the Speedtail uses an advanced hybrid powertrain to achieve its 250 mph goal, emphasizing aero-efficiency with its iconic “Longtail” silhouette.
Czinger 21C V Max (253 mph+)
Czinger uses 3D-printing and AI-driven manufacturing to create the 21C. The V Max variant is specifically tuned to minimize drag, proving that the future of the world’s fastest road cars lies in advanced manufacturing techniques.
Koenigsegg Regera (255 mph)
The Regera eliminated the traditional gearbox entirely, using a direct-drive system that delivers power with startling linearity. It remains one of the most sophisticated engineering feats of the last decade.
SSC Ultimate Aero (256 mph)
A veteran of the 250+ mph club, the Ultimate Aero was the car that finally dethroned the Bugatti Veyron in the late 2000s, proving that “Made in the USA” hypercars belong on the world stage.
Rimac Nevera & Nevera R (258–268 mph)
The Nevera R is the current electric standard-bearer. With massive torque figures and an 800V architecture, it provides a glimpse into the future where electric motors make combustion engines look archaic.
Bugatti Veyron Super Sport (268 mph)
The Veyron changed the world. Even by 2026 standards, its quad-turbo W16 engine is a masterpiece of internal combustion that defined the modern hypercar era.
Hennessey Venom F5 (271.6 mph)
Hennessey’s pursuit of the 300 mph barrier is legendary. The F5, with its 1,817 hp twin-turbo V8, is built specifically for high-speed stability and linear acceleration.
Bugatti Tourbillon (277 mph – est)
The successor to the Chiron, the Tourbillon introduces a hybrid V16 powertrain. It is expected to set new standards in luxury and velocity upon its full rollout.
Koenigsegg Agera RS (277.87 mph)
The Agera RS holds a special place in history for its officially verified runs on public highways, proving its capabilities outside of controlled test tracks.
Bugatti Mistral (282.05 mph)
The Mistral is currently the world’s fastest road-legal convertible. It proves that open-top driving does not have to sacrifice aerodynamic efficiency.
SSC Tuatara (282.9 mph)
After overcoming initial controversy, the Tuatara secured its place in the record books. Its 5.9-liter V8 is a testament to American tuning culture at its absolute peak.
Bugatti Chiron Super Sport 300+ (304.8 mph)
This was the first production-based car to break the 300 mph barrier. It remains a crowning achievement for the Molsheim-based brand and a benchmark for automotive engineering.
Koenigsegg Jesko Absolut (310 mph – target)
Designed specifically to minimize drag, the Jesko Absolut is the weapon Koenigsegg is using to claim the ultimate crown. Every facet of its design is optimized for one goal: total speed supremacy.
Yangwang U9 Xtreme (308 mph)
The Yangwang U9 Xtreme represents the shift in the global automotive landscape. Utilizing a 1,200V architecture and four high-output electric motors, it achieves blistering speeds while maintaining road-legal compliance, signaling that the future of the world’s fastest road cars has officially gone electric.
